i don't know where to get help so i came here to see if anyone could answer my question. i have a problem which is that i wanted to upload my photos in a digital cam. i got the program installed into my computer already, just that i couldn't find my "removable disk" and thus i couldn't upload my photos. is it that i do not have the removable disk program or what? help please.

Hi,
Have you got your USB connection plugged in?
What O/S are you running (usually winxp/98 is required)?
Did you follow the installation instructions exactly (many of these things require you to install the software BEFORE plugging in your camera)
Are you running the latest Service Pack for your version of windows?
Is your camera turned on?

If you are happy with the above, I suggest you contact the support centre / company that you bought your camera from.
You could also google for the make and model of your camera and the word "problem", or "XP" or some such.
